EMS Assessor Training: Complex Housing Modifications Workshop
The two day interactive workshop will include the required EMS Assessor competency requirements for Complex Housing Assessments;
Case studies
Client perspectives on assessment
Assessment models
Typical modifications
Evaluation of outcomes
Identifying environmental barriers
Typical features of NZ homes
Reading plans
Measuring and drawing
Challenging behaviour
NASC collaboration
Note: as per the Ministry update on credentialing requirements. All EMS Assessors holding the complex housing credential will have to complete the housing workshop once only; either prior to becoming credentialled, or within three years of becoming credentialled.
About the trainer
David Guest is an Occupational Therapist (OT) with over 30 years of experience, based in Waikato, New Zealand.
David has always worked in the area of housing modifications; as a community OT with the District Health Board, with Enable New Zealand in the administration of funding for housing modifications, and in private practice. Through his career, David has been heavily involved in the development of Ministry policy for housing modifications and OT competency requirements. From 2001 - 2006, David was part of the team closing the Kimberley Centre in Taitoko (Levin) providing 66 modified group houses to residents leaving the institution. David also developed and runs the Show Your Ability roadshow.
As the sole contracted nationwide provider of OT housing modification workshops for Whiakaha Ministry of Disabled People, David has delivered over 60 workshops to more than 800 Occupational Therapists. He has delivered over 30 ACC workshops with overwhelmingly positive responses from participants.
David is in private practice undertaking housing assessments for ACC in the Auckland, Waikato and Bay of Plenty areas.
